I have some weather files in TM2 format, how can I convert them into formats that is readable by SAM?

It is true that SAM can read weather files in the TMY2 (.tm2), TMY3 (.csv), and EPW (.epw) formats in addition to its own SAM CSV (.csv) format.
You can use the "Solar Resource File Converter" to convert from TMY2, TMY3 or EPW formats to SAM CSV. The macro only converts the data SAM uses from the original file, so it is a way to get a cleaner weather file. To use the macro, start SAM and create a PV or CSP case, and then click Macros at the bottom left of the main window to display a list of macros. To run the macro, click the "Run macro" button at the top of the window.
